One such game is The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time. Released on the Nintendo 64 in 1998, it redefined the action-adventure genre. Its blend of immersive world-building, puzzle-solving, and an emotional storyline made it a groundbreaking title for its time. Players took on the role of Link, journeying through a vast world to stop the evil forces threatening the land of Hyrule. The game’s expansive world, along with its innovative mechanics, set a new standard for open-world games that would influence countless titles in the years to come.

Another example of a game that ranks among the best is The Last of Us. Released on the PlayStation 3 in 2013, this action-adventure game, developed by Naughty Dog, was a masterclass in storytelling. Set in a post-apocalyptic world, players follow the emotional journey of Joel and Ellie as they navigate through a world ravaged by an infectious outbreak. The game’s haunting atmosphere, combined with its emotionally gripping narrative and superb voice acting, has garnered widespread critical acclaim. It was also praised for its intricate world-building, where every corner told a story of survival, loss, and hope.

Moving into the world of competitive gaming, Super Mario Bros. is often regarded as one of the best games ever created. Originally released in 1985, it became the face of the Nintendo Entertainment System and single-handedly popularized platformers. Its simple yet challenging gameplay set the foundation for future games in the genre. Mario’s quest to rescue Princess Peach from the clutches of Bowser introduced millions of players to the concept of side-scrolling platformers, with meticulously designed levels and innovative power-ups that would go on to influence generations of platforming games.

One of the defining PlayStation games is Horizon Zero Dawn. Released in 2017, this open-world action RPG follows the journey of Aloy, a young hunter in a post-apocalyptic world overrun by robotic creatures. The game’s vast, beautifully crafted world and its unique blend of exploration, combat, and story quickly captured the hearts of players. mudah4d Horizon Zero Dawn was praised for its innovative gameplay, including the use of a variety of weapons and tactics to take down mechanical foes. The game’s narrative, which explored themes of technology, humanity, and nature, was equally compelling, offering players an emotional and thought-provoking experience. The success of Horizon Zero Dawn led to the highly anticipated sequel, Horizon Forbidden West, which continues to expand the universe and build upon the original’s success.

Another game that solidified PlayStation’s reputation as a leader in gaming is Bloodborne. Created by the developers of the Dark Souls series, Bloodborne is a gothic horror action RPG set in the dark, twisted city of Yharnam. The game’s intense combat, atmospheric world, and challenging difficulty made it an instant classic. Players assume the role of the Hunter, tasked with eradicating nightmarish creatures while unraveling the city’s mysterious past. The game’s fast-paced combat system, which encourages aggressive play and precise timing, was a departure from the slower, methodical combat of Dark Souls and gave Bloodborne a unique feel. Its intricate world-building and hauntingly beautiful design made Bloodborne one of the standout titles in PlayStation’s library, earning it widespread acclaim from both critics and players alike.

Spider-Man, released in 2018, is another PlayStation exclusive that redefined superhero games. Developed by Insomniac Games, Spider-Man offered players the chance to step into the shoes of Peter Parker as he battles iconic villains and explores a massive, open-world Manhattan. The game’s fluid web-swinging mechanics, engaging combat, and heartfelt story made it a standout in the superhero genre. Players could swing through the city, stop crimes, and engage in side missions while following a compelling narrative that explored Peter’s struggles as both a superhero and a person. The game was praised for its attention to detail, from the stunning recreation of New York City to the authentic portrayal of Peter Parker’s character. Spider-Man proved that PlayStation could deliver both an action-packed, open-world experience and a deeply emotional story.
